Talent.com
serp_jobs.error_messages.no_longer_accepting
Software Engineering Co-Op

Software Engineering Co-Op

FMJohnston, Rhode Island, US
job_description.job_card.30_days_ago
serp_jobs.job_preview.job_type
  • serp_jobs.job_card.full_time
job_description.job_card.job_description

Established nearly two centuries ago, FM is a leading mutual insurance company whose capital, scientific research capability and engineering expertise are solely dedicated to property risk management and the resilience of its policyholder-owners. These owners, who share the belief that the majority of property loss is preventable, represent many of the world's largest organizations, including one of every four Fortune 500 companies. They work with FM to better understand the hazards that can impact their business continuity to make cost-effective risk management decisions, combining property loss prevention with insurance protection.

This US-based remote opportunity may require periodic travel to our corporate headquarters in Johnston, RI, which is part of the greater Providence area.

With a large college-age population, Providence offers a vibrant arts and entertainment scene that includes local theatre and music, collegiate and minor league sporting events, and excellent restaurants, and we're not that far from the breathtaking RI beaches!

Schedule

  • Must be able to work full time 37.5 hours a week for January- June 2026.
  • Hours : 9am to 5pm EST Monday- Friday

FM is hiring a Software Engineering Co-Op to join our team for the Spring 2026 School Term, Full-time for 6 months.

This is an excellent opportunity for motivated students to apply their classroom experience, professional attitude, and personal ambition. You will get firsthand experience while earning college credits and getting paid!

As a software development co-op, you will have the opportunity to work on real-world problems and solutions with a team of talented developers. Your projects may consist of developing or modifying business applications, integrating business applications and databases, augmenting rapid software delivery and deployment processes, and automating software testing.

Education

Must be enrolled as a full-time student studying Computer Science, or related degree program degree during the Spring 2026 Semester to be considered.

Technical Skills

Knowledge of Theory and principles of software engineering

Proficiency in high-level programming languages :

  • Objected Oriented Programming : C# or Java
  • SQL or Oracle
  • Typescript, REACT, Angular or JavaScript
  • Personal projects with technical skills listed and Student involvement on campus a plus!

    Soft Skills

    Ability to work effectively in teams and solve problems

    Desire and willingness to learn new technologies

    The hiring range for this position is $24.00 to $33.00 per hour. The final salary offer will vary based on geographic location, individual education, skills, and experience.

    FM is an Equal Opportunity Employer and is committed to attracting, developing, and retaining a diverse workforce.

    serp_jobs.job_alerts.create_a_job

    Software Engineering • Johnston, Rhode Island, US

    Job_description.internal_linking.related_jobs
    • serp_jobs.job_card.promoted
    Application Architect

    Application Architect

    VirtualVocationsCranston, Rhode Island, United States
    serp_jobs.job_card.full_time
    A company is looking for an Application Architect to define and drive technical strategy for scalable, cloud-native enterprise applications. Key Responsibilities : Establish and maintain the archit...serp_jobs.internal_linking.show_moreserp_jobs.last_updated.last_updated_30
    • serp_jobs.job_card.promoted
    California Licensed Cloud Engineer

    California Licensed Cloud Engineer

    VirtualVocationsCranston, Rhode Island, United States
    serp_jobs.job_card.full_time
    A company is looking for a Lead Platform / Cloud Engineer.Key Responsibilities Develop and manage deployment pipelines using Terraform and Kubernetes Modernize components and improve core infrastr...serp_jobs.internal_linking.show_moreserp_jobs.last_updated.last_updated_1_day
    • serp_jobs.job_card.promoted
    Senior Azure Cloud Engineer

    Senior Azure Cloud Engineer

    VirtualVocationsCranston, Rhode Island, United States
    serp_jobs.job_card.full_time
    A company is looking for a Hybrid Cloud Engineer Senior.Key Responsibilities Design, implement, and maintain Azure infrastructure using Infrastructure as Code (IaC) Architect and configure virtu...serp_jobs.internal_linking.show_moreserp_jobs.last_updated.last_updated_30
    • serp_jobs.job_card.promoted
    Senior Linux Engineer

    Senior Linux Engineer

    VirtualVocationsCranston, Rhode Island, United States
    serp_jobs.job_card.full_time
    A company is looking for a Senior Data Center Linux Engineer.Key Responsibilities Manage, configure, and maintain Linux servers Troubleshoot performance issues, hardware failures, and software b...serp_jobs.internal_linking.show_moreserp_jobs.last_updated.last_updated_30
    • serp_jobs.job_card.promoted
    Oracle HCM Cloud Developer

    Oracle HCM Cloud Developer

    VirtualVocationsCranston, Rhode Island, United States
    serp_jobs.job_card.full_time
    A company is looking for an Oracle HCM Cloud Conversion Developer.Key Responsibilities Develop and implement data conversion strategies for Oracle HCM Cloud systems Design and automate data conv...serp_jobs.internal_linking.show_moreserp_jobs.last_updated.last_updated_1_day
    • serp_jobs.job_card.promoted
    Full-Stack Engineer

    Full-Stack Engineer

    VirtualVocationsCranston, Rhode Island, United States
    serp_jobs.job_card.full_time
    A company is looking for a Full-Stack Engineer to architect, develop, and maintain software solutions in a fintech and proptech ecosystem. Key Responsibilities Design and implement scalable back-e...serp_jobs.internal_linking.show_moreserp_jobs.last_updated.last_updated_30
    • serp_jobs.job_card.promoted
    Applications Developer 3

    Applications Developer 3

    VirtualVocationsCranston, Rhode Island, United States
    serp_jobs.job_card.full_time
    A company is looking for an Applications Developer 3 to join their IT transformation team.Key Responsibilities Collaborate with engineers to support IT transformation initiatives Design and deve...serp_jobs.internal_linking.show_moreserp_jobs.last_updated.last_updated_1_day
    • serp_jobs.job_card.promoted
    AWS Cloud Developer

    AWS Cloud Developer

    VirtualVocationsCranston, Rhode Island, United States
    serp_jobs.job_card.full_time
    A company is looking for an AWS Cloud Developer to support an ERP System Implementation on a consulting basis.Key Responsibilities Implement standard AWS components such as VPC, security groups, ...serp_jobs.internal_linking.show_moreserp_jobs.last_updated.last_updated_30
    • serp_jobs.job_card.promoted
    DevSecOps Engineer

    DevSecOps Engineer

    VirtualVocationsCranston, Rhode Island, United States
    serp_jobs.job_card.full_time
    A company is looking for a DevSecOps Engineer to design, implement, and maintain CI / CD pipelines and integrate security tools into the development lifecycle. Key Responsibilities Design, implement...serp_jobs.internal_linking.show_moreserp_jobs.last_updated.last_updated_30
    • serp_jobs.job_card.promoted
    GCP Cloud Architect

    GCP Cloud Architect

    VirtualVocationsCranston, Rhode Island, United States
    serp_jobs.job_card.full_time
    A company is looking for a GCP Cloud Architect.Key Responsibilities Design and implement cloud architectures on Google Cloud Platform (GCP) Lead the migration of on-premises infrastructure to GC...serp_jobs.internal_linking.show_moreserp_jobs.last_updated.last_updated_variable_days
    • serp_jobs.job_card.promoted
    • serp_jobs.job_card.new
    DevOps Developer

    DevOps Developer

    VirtualVocationsCranston, Rhode Island, United States
    serp_jobs.job_card.full_time
    A company is looking for a DevOps Developer (AWS).Key Responsibilities Design, develop, and maintain Python-based backend services Create and manage CI / CD pipelines for efficient deployments Op...serp_jobs.internal_linking.show_moreserp_jobs.last_updated.last_updated_variable_hours
    • serp_jobs.job_card.promoted
    Senior Release Engineer

    Senior Release Engineer

    VirtualVocationsCranston, Rhode Island, United States
    serp_jobs.job_card.full_time
    A company is looking for a Senior Release Engineer to manage and enhance its release infrastructure and processes.Key Responsibilities Own and evolve CI / CD infrastructure and release processes wi...serp_jobs.internal_linking.show_moreserp_jobs.last_updated.last_updated_variable_days
    • serp_jobs.job_card.promoted
    Senior Middleware Engineer

    Senior Middleware Engineer

    VirtualVocationsCranston, Rhode Island, United States
    serp_jobs.job_card.full_time
    A company is looking for an Infrastructure Middleware Engineer Senior.Key Responsibilities Manage Middleware products / environments, including installations, upgrades, maintenance, and tuning Pro...serp_jobs.internal_linking.show_moreserp_jobs.last_updated.last_updated_30
    • serp_jobs.job_card.promoted
    Senior IT Engineer

    Senior IT Engineer

    VirtualVocationsCranston, Rhode Island, United States
    serp_jobs.job_card.full_time
    A company is looking for a Senior IT Engineer (IAM).Key Responsibilities Design and standardize the IAM lifecycle and associated workflows for employee accounts Drive automation and manage workf...serp_jobs.internal_linking.show_moreserp_jobs.last_updated.last_updated_30
    • serp_jobs.job_card.promoted
    Integration Architect

    Integration Architect

    VirtualVocationsCranston, Rhode Island, United States
    serp_jobs.job_card.full_time
    A company is looking for a Modernization Architect (Integration).Key Responsibilities Architect and implement integration solutions using IBM MQ, REST APIs, and event-driven patterns Lead applic...serp_jobs.internal_linking.show_moreserp_jobs.last_updated.last_updated_30
    • serp_jobs.job_card.promoted
    Application Developer II

    Application Developer II

    VirtualVocationsCranston, Rhode Island, United States
    serp_jobs.job_card.full_time
    A company is looking for an Application Developer II.Key Responsibilities Reviews, analyzes, modifies, creates, debugs, and tests applications Implements code and documents system changes based ...serp_jobs.internal_linking.show_moreserp_jobs.last_updated.last_updated_1_day
    • serp_jobs.job_card.promoted
    Ohio Licensed Senior Cloud Architect

    Ohio Licensed Senior Cloud Architect

    VirtualVocationsCranston, Rhode Island, United States
    serp_jobs.job_card.full_time
    A company is looking for a Senior Architect.Key Responsibilities Architect, strategize, and deploy advanced Microsoft Azure infrastructure solutions Oversee and execute enterprise-grade Azure in...serp_jobs.internal_linking.show_moreserp_jobs.last_updated.last_updated_1_day
    • serp_jobs.job_card.promoted
    • serp_jobs.job_card.new
    Internal Applications Developer

    Internal Applications Developer

    VirtualVocationsCranston, Rhode Island, United States
    serp_jobs.job_card.full_time
    A company is looking for an Internal Applications Developer to create internal open source tools for employees.Key Responsibilities Develop and design robust and scalable software solutions using...serp_jobs.internal_linking.show_moreserp_jobs.last_updated.last_updated_1_hour
    • serp_jobs.job_card.promoted
    Senior Application Architect

    Senior Application Architect

    VirtualVocationsCranston, Rhode Island, United States
    serp_jobs.job_card.full_time
    A company is looking for a Senior Application Architect to design, develop, and oversee the implementation of enterprise-level applications. Key Responsibilities Design and document application ar...serp_jobs.internal_linking.show_moreserp_jobs.last_updated.last_updated_30
    • serp_jobs.job_card.promoted
    Systems Administrator

    Systems Administrator

    VirtualVocationsCranston, Rhode Island, United States
    serp_jobs.job_card.full_time
    A company is looking for a Systems Administrator.Key Responsibilities Installs, configures, troubleshoots, and maintains server configurations to ensure their confidentiality, integrity, and avai...serp_jobs.internal_linking.show_moreserp_jobs.last_updated.last_updated_30